
izzy's playlists!

#extradirty
tumblr dot com

Discoholic 🪩
🪼
Claire Keane
I'd rather be in outer space 🛸

Product Placement

PR's Tumblrdome
wallacepolsom
dirt enthusiast

@theartofmadeline
d e v o n
art blog(derogatory)

⁂
"I'm Dorothy Gale from Kansas"
RMH
One Nice Bug Per Day
DEAR READER
almost home
seen from Bangladesh
seen from United Kingdom

seen from Türkiye

seen from United States
seen from United States
seen from Russia

seen from Türkiye

seen from Türkiye
seen from Netherlands

seen from Iraq

seen from United Kingdom
seen from Canada

seen from Netherlands

seen from United States
seen from United States

seen from Australia
seen from Canada
seen from United States

seen from United States
seen from Canada
@flamagenitus

Anya is live and ready to show you everything. Watch her strip, dance, and perform exclusive shows just for you. Interact in real-time and make your fantasies come true.
Free to watch • No registration required • HD streaming
finally, it has appeared on my dash
finally, when we least expected it.
Wasn’t expecting this
I’m sorry I know this is normally just an art and rambling blog you didn’t honestly expect me to pass up reblogging The Spanish Inquisition did you? Because nobody expects the Spanish Inquisition.
This post is 13 years old, let that sink in
i couldn’t let that sink in because I would have to expect seeing it.
and-
and nobody-
and nobody expects-
*jumps into frame* “NO ONE EXPECTS THE SPANISH INQUISITION!”
@hellsite-hall-of-fame @heritageposts
I did not reblog this when I saw it appear on my dash. No, other mutuals would have already seen it. I have scheduled this post a month in advance. None of my mutuals expect to see this post on their dash again now. Not even I, because I have probably already forgotten about ever doing this.
NOBODY EXPECTS THE SPANISH INQUISITION!!!
awesome picture how do i move on now from this moment
did a bit of driving through the state of georgia today and wound up driving through a small town that i later discovered was called newborn, which is an odd name but doesn’t technically have anything wrong with it, except for the fact that i nearly gave myself whiplash doing a double-take at a building sign advertising NEWBORN TAXIDERMY

Anya is live and ready to show you everything. Watch her strip, dance, and perform exclusive shows just for you. Interact in real-time and make your fantasies come true.
Free to watch • No registration required • HD streaming
It's easy to stay motivated to get outside and go places when Guillermo del Toro is walking behind you, pushing you forward with his psychic powers.
Remember to always examine your first impulse, your first thought, your first disgust response.
Your feelings are important, but they are not immutable facts about the world around you.
im swimming at the lake and accidentally kicked a fish. this has never happened in my many years of swimming. sorry man
*swims past*
every fucking day brother
you guys do realize memorizing a story doesn't actually preserve it right? it just destroys it entirely and places a perfect copy of it in your brain to be retold at a future performance

Anya is live and ready to show you everything. Watch her strip, dance, and perform exclusive shows just for you. Interact in real-time and make your fantasies come true.
Free to watch • No registration required • HD streaming
I try not to fall into the "I never liked their work anyway" ditch when an artist/creator reveals themself to be a terrible person
BUT
a feeling I do have and will stand by is "While I enjoyed their work overall I did have some gripes that I overlooked out of affection and whimsy, but now that my loyalty is gone and my affection tainted there is nothing holding me back from enumerating my many grievances, to which the revelations of the creator's shittiness may or may not provide a new and infuriating context."
As someone who collects a LOT of physical media but doesn’t make a lot of money, I want to share the rule that keeps my wallet from crying out in despair every time I enter a store. I don’t remember who I got this from, but thank you whoever you are because it has been a game-changer when it comes to building a large collection without breaking the bank.
The $1 per hour rule. It’s exactly what it says on the tin. If I’m purchasing physical media, I consider it good value if I can expect to get at least one hour of enjoyment for every dollar I spend on it.
I don’t remember what I spent on BG3, but I know it was a good deal because I’ve logged 600 hours in it. Hades II costs $30, and I was more than happy to pay that because I know I’ll play it for at least 30 hours. When I add books to my library, I almost exclusively buy used books that cost under $5 because 5 hours is a good average estimate for how long it takes me to finish a novel.
Will there be a treat you splurge on every now and then? Of course, but $1 per hour is a good standard to stick to if you want to responsibly build a dragon's hoard of physical media.
Wacom recently asked me to talk about why I make queer comics, and given there are multiple bills right now floating around in congress that are effectively "we will kill your livelihood if we get a sniff of queer" I had some pretty strong, simply feelings to relay.
You can read the interview here, you can buy my graphic novel featuring a gay vampire here, and you can call your congressmen about rejecting HR 2616, HR 8705, HR 7661 using 5calls.org (they don't have these specific bills listed as things to call about, but luckily you can talk about whatever you want on the phone)
birth of venus
this is in excel btw. and this image is exactly half green and half pink. and for each shade of green there is an equal number of "opposite" pink pixels. and this represents a major leap forward in excel macro use by me
the origin of this concept was, oh, what if you were trying to recreate an image as a tapestry? and you had, say, 24 colors of yarn? and you wanted the image to have equal amounts of each color of yarn? how would you effectively use the yarn you had to create the image? you'd have to look at all the colors of the original image, then look at your yarn colors, and find some consistent method for choosing what original colors are replaced with what yarn colors. but then it turns out there's a lot of different rules you could imagine or follow, which produce different-looking images. and you can end up with something like this:
which is cool. and it would be cool to say, find a granny square cardigan pattern with 24 squares, knit these squares, make a sick cardigan. but then i realized i don't know how to knit or anything. and once you accept that there isn't really a clear "application" and this concept lives on a screen, you open yourself up to more possibilities. a la birth of venus.
step 1: python script that looks at the original image and generates an excel spreadsheet the same dimensions (793 x 1322 pixels = 793 x 1322 cells), and each cell is populated with the hex code of the color that appears in that pixel of the original image
step 2: excel macro to generate list of every unique hex code that appears in the excel spreadsheet.
step 3: excel macro to calculate the R, G, B values of each of those hex codes.
step 4: excel macro to fill each cell with the color of that hex code (not necessary, i just like to do it).
step 5: I add in Saturation (the difference between the largest and smallest RGB value) and Lightness (average of all RGB values).
step 6: pick a color palette. i always find myself gravitating towards groovy seventies palettes with warm reds and oranges, so i decided not to do that this time. i looked on coolors and found a color palette that was all dark greens that were similar to each other. there were only like four colors or something in this palette. and to make it truly different from the other project, there should be a small gradient. so i determined the smallest possible change between colors and used an excel macro to color it. i was going to stop here and do the entire image in shades of green (inspired by that guy on tiktok that paints using only one color) but then. idk. i realized the "opposite" of each color was an equally subtly changing pink. so i imagined that the end of this process would be an "abstract" image, with subtle variations of pink and green, that would end up suggesting birth of venus.
so all told, i had 502 unique replacement colors, 251 of which are green, 251 of which are pink. (793 x 1322) / 502 = either 2088 or 2089 of each color.
step 7: find some method for finding the difference between the original colors of the image and my new color palette. I use a method of comparing, R, G, B, S and L:
((abs(R1 - R2) + abs(G1 - G2) + abs(B1 - B2)) / 3) + abs(S1 - S2) + abs(L1 - L2)
and you come up with something like this. on the left, those are colors that appear in the original image. across the top, those greens are the colors i'm replacing it with. in blue, that's the number of each new color i have to work with (it's just blue for contrast). and in the center, this pink area, that's a giant spreadsheet with the "objective" difference between each original color and each replacement color. it's pink because i have some conditional formatting applied, ignore that part.
and in this situation, you have some choices to make. in the original image up there, i used a schema prioritizing light and dark--i.e., i looked at the darkest color (pure black) that appeared in the original image, then found the closest replacement color (i.e., the replacement color with the smallest number). then did the same with the lightest color. then the next darkest, next lightest.
but i'm going to do it slightly differently this time. and i don't know how this image will come out looking.
if you look at the "first" green, closest to the left, and sort by smallest to largest:
you can see that these colors on the left are closest to the "first" green i've decided to work with. that might seem odd. i mean, #7F9800--> #00a94f are pretty close, but #A95400 is red. but that's just a difference in hue. really, #A95400 and #00a94f are very similar in lightness and saturation.
and this also calculates the number of times that color actually appears in the original image. that first specific green, #7F9800, only appears twice. but some colors, like actual black #000000, appear something like 46,000 times. and if you add all the numbers in the "frequency" column, it should exactly equal the sum of each replacement color (2088 ish x 502).
step 8: excel macro again. this one is complicated. basically it sorts that first "green" column (column E in my spreadsheet) from smallest to largest. then it adds each cell in the "frequency" column until it reaches or surpasses the blue cell above column E, which for this particular color is 2089. it copies those "original image" colors and their respective frequencies over to another sheet. for the color that surpassed 2089, it splits in two. then it deletes that column E. Then it makes sure "frequency" and "replacement color sum" still total. then it runs again on the new column E, until the whole spreadsheet is used up. and it generates something like:
[color from original image] [number of times that color appears] [replacement color, filled in]
and there's approximately 8000 lines of that.
i have the replacement colors in the order above. starting with vivid green, slowing transitioning to dark green, switching abruptly to bright pink, slowly transitioning to pale pink.
step 9: another excel macro. this one looks at original image broken down into hex codes, then looks at the generated list and replaces each [original] color with the replacement color, that exact number of times.
end result of these macros, following different "rules" of assigning replacement colors to original colors, is this:
which looks different, obviously. but it is the exact replacement colors, and same number of each replacement color, as the original up there.
at maximum efficiency, it took about 20 minutes to complete step 8 and 9. i have a vision of creating a series of these, each time "starting" with the next replacement color, and then making a gif of it. idk how to make gifs though
@magnetictapedatastorage seems up your alley
did someone just reinvent the jacquard loom in excel
The recent hot VS cold polls have made me realise that a lot of people have no idea how to cool down.
As someone from a hot country that's regularly on fire, here's some tips:
WATER IS YOUR FRIEND! WATER! IS! YOUR! FRIEND! You can transfer SO much heat into this bad boy! You cannot cool down without water!
Wrists under the cold tap. Splash your face and the back of your neck. Fan yourself.
In some countries you can buy a little handeld fan with a water sprayer.
Damp tea towel around the neck. Stick an ice pack in there on hotter days.
Half fill a water bottle with water, stick in freezer. If you use a bottle with a straw, make sure it's lying on its side with the straw side up and out of the water. When frozen top up the rest of the way with tap water and off you go.
Desperate to cool off? Wet T-shirt. Sit in front of a fan. This will nuke it, just don't get hypothermia and don't fall asleep like this.
Cold showers are also your friend in summer. Some people get psyched up by these. Personally, I sleep like a baby, so I'm good to have them before bed. Just keep in mind that it takes a bit of time for the cool to circulate, so your body will tell you that you're colder than you actually are. I find that when I have cold showers I need to step out of the spray when I think I'm cold... I'll just wait, and thirty seconds later the temperature has evened out and I actually need to step under again. Rinse and repeat until you maintain coolness even after stepping out for a bit.
If you can't do cold showers, turn the cold shower on anyway and just stick your arms under. When they're cold, lift your arms up above your head. The sensation of cool blood draining into your body is fucking weird and kinda unpleasant but less unpleasant than being hot.
Feet in a tub of water with ice. Blood naturally flows to your extremities when hot, so take advantage of this. If you don't have a tub of ice water, sticking a wet rag on your feet in front of the fan works too, it's the less powerful version of the wet T-shirt.
Drinks lots of water but make sure that water has electrolytes as well. Stay in the shade.
Keep air circulating. Fans don't actually cool rooms down, they just help transfer heat from your body to the moisture on your skin or the air via evaporative cooling.
Block north facing windows early in the morning so the sun doesn't get in. If you're in the northern hemisphere, this is opposite for you. Keep in mind that if your home is brick, the bricks will still heat up and slowly release heat into your home even after the sun goes down so this will only do so much.
If it's hotter inside than outside, close all your windows but two, making sure they're on opposite sides of the house/unit you're in. Point a fan out of one window, making sure that the doors between the rooms with the open windows are all open. This will help create a mini pressure system in your home, pulling cooler air in and pushing the hotter air out via the fan. Bonus points if you can get that fan high up where the hot air rises; even within a single room the top is much hotter than the air by the floor. Adjust the amount of open windows based on how many fans you have, but generally you want more windows with fans open than windows without fans to keep the pressure correct.
Obviously, use your common sense for these. Not everything WILL work for you, just use the stuff that does and adjust what needs to be adjusted. Some of these will be impossible to use in the workplace but others you can still use. Others are best used at home. If humidity impacts your ability to use any of these, get a dehumidifier if that's an option, or use more ice instead of evaporation.
Also keep in mind that the skinnier you are, the faster these will work. More fat means more insulation, means more heat, so you may need to be more patient with some of these or use them in combination.
Bringing this back for my dying mutuals

Anya is live and ready to show you everything. Watch her strip, dance, and perform exclusive shows just for you. Interact in real-time and make your fantasies come true.
Free to watch • No registration required • HD streaming
Holy mother of curb theory those are GOOD
See what happens when we do things for disabled people? We get shot like this that's just better for *everyone* AND accommodates for wheelchair users
The hoodies are $59. That is straight up a normal hoodie price that is AMAZING
Creating adaptive clothing and accessories designed to bring joy and confidence while increasing your quality of life. Discover products to
Also noting that this line has a lot of clothing that works for people who need easy chest access or have limited upper body mobility, like if you are recovering from surgery or doing chemo
children of any species are very good at being annoying and very cute while doing that
a sphinx child based on this post